Block 142,923
Block Hash
eb62317045881a3e65f9a6957d048dab34dd3a24cd848d07fd81884e32
3aec17
Previous Block Hash
9775412a277ac6235ada0d31f8cc718e77b81e669b75388186af171190 84f0e9
Mined
Transactions
1
Difficulty
2.28 M
Size
175 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E